The Acta de asamblea formato in Montgomery serves as a formal record of the annual meeting of stockholders for a corporation. It documents essential details, including the date, attendees, quorum confirmations, and the agenda of the meeting. The form allows users to record motions made for the approval of the agenda, minutes from the last meeting, and company business, ensuring transparency and compliance with corporate governance. Key features include spaces for listing stockholders present both in person and by proxy, as well as sections for nominations and votes on board directors. Filling out the form involves clearly noting names, percentages of shares, and recording motions with appropriate seconding, making it straightforward even for users unfamiliar with legal documents.
